CHICAGO - Marylandian -- A simple innovation may soon change one of the most common daily routines. Pocket Wipe is an innovative toilet paper concept featuring an integrated protective hand pocket designed to help reduce direct contact between the user's hand and used tissue during wiping.
Unlike conventional toilet paper, Pocket Wipe incorporates a built-in pocket that allows the hand to remain enclosed while maintaining flexibility and control. The result is a cleaner, more hygienic experience without significantly changing how consumers already use toilet paper.
The design may appeal to families, caregivers, seniors, healthcare environments, childcare facilities, hospitality businesses, and consumers seeking greater confidence in personal hygiene.
